The HP FlexNetwork MSR958 router combines multiple high-speed Ethernet ports and flexible connection options into a rack-mountable design. It integrates LAN, WAN, and SFP ports to support diverse network topologies, fitting into enterprise and data center environments as a core routing solution. |
| General Information | |
|---|---|
| Brand | HP |
| Technical Information | |
|---|---|
| WAN Type | Ethernet |
| WAN Ports | 1 |
| LAN Ports | 8 |
| POE Support | No |
| Connector Type | RJ-45,SFP |
| SFP / SFP+ Ports | 1 |
| Built-in Modem | None |
| Management Interface | Web GUI, CLI (SSH/Telnet), SNMP |
| Routing & Protocols | |
|---|---|
| Multi-WAN / Load Balancing | Yes |
| NAT Support | Yes |
| Routing Protocols | Static, RIP, OSPF, BGP, VRRP, IGMP, Policy-Based Routing (PBR) |
| Networking Features | |
|---|---|
| VPN Support | IPSec, L2TP, GRE |
| SNMP Support | SNMPv3 |
| QoS Support | Basic QoS, DSCP, Traffic Shaping, Traffic Policing |
| Firewall | Zone-Based |
| VLAN Support | Yes |
| Management Interfaces | Web GUI,CLI (SSH/Telnet),SNMP |
| Physical Characteristics | |
|---|---|
| Enclosure Type | Rack-Mountable 1U |
| Condition | Refurbished |
| Weight | 3.00 |
